The Starrett 569 series tube micrometer has a vertical cylindrical anvil for measuring tubing wall thickness, and a vernier scale in inch units for taking precise outside diameter (OD) measurements. The vernier scale on the thimble and sleeve is graduated to 0.001†and has a satin chrome rust- and glare-resistant finish. The micrometer is made of high-grade tool steel with a black enamel finish for protection and durability. The spindle has a micro-lapped measuring face for accuracy and is carbide-tipped for wear resistance.Micrometers are precision measuring instruments that use a calibrated screw to measure small distances. These measurements are translated into large rotations of the screw that are then able to be read from a scale or a dial. Micrometers are typically used in manufacturing, machining, and mechanical engineering. There are three types of micrometer: outside, inside, and depth. Outside micrometers may also be called micrometer calipers, and are used to measure the length, width, or outside diameter of an object. Inside micrometers are typically used to measure interior diameter, as in a hole. Depth micrometers measure the height, or depth, of any shape that has a step, groove, or slot.The L.S. Starrett Company manufactures precision measuring tools, metrology and testing equipment, and saw blade products. The company was founded in 1880 and is headquartered in Athol, MA.

The Mitutoyo 293-340-30 digital micrometer is for taking outside diameter measurements in harsh workshop conditions. The micrometer has a measurement range of 0 to 1" (0 to 25mm), resolution of 0.00005" (0.001mm), and an accuracy of +/- 0.00005". The LCD screen displays in inches and metric units. The micrometer's plastic components are oil-resistant and measuring faces are carbide-tipped for durability. A ratchet-stop mechanism helps provide uniform pressure for precise, repeatable measurements. This gauge is Ingress Protection certified IP65 for protection against dust and water.Functions offered by this model include origin point setting, zero setting, hold, automatic on and off after 20 minutes of idle time, function lock, and an alarm in case of computing error or low-voltage. It has a battery life of approximately 1.2 years of normal use. The Brown & Sharpe TESA Isomaster standard outside micrometer has a vernier scale in inch units for taking precise outside diameter (OD) measurements, a friction drive thimble mechanism for uniform pressure during adjustment, and tungsten carbide faces for wear resistance.The micrometer’s frame is heat-insulated to help reduce temperature-related expansion or contraction. The vernier scale on the thimble and sleeve is graduated to 0.0001â€, with slanted markings on the barrel to help reduce parallax errors when reading, and a satin chrome rust- and glare-resistant finish. The spindle and anvil have flat measuring faces and are carbide-tipped for wear resistance. A spindle lock helps provide secure locking of the measurement position. The micrometer comes with a plastic case for storage.Micrometers are precision measuring instruments that use a calibrated screw to measure small distances. These measurements are translated into large rotations of the screw that are then able to be read from a scale or a dial. Micrometers are typically used in manufacturing, machining, and mechanical engineering. There are three types of micrometer: outside, inside, and depth. Outside micrometers may also be called micrometer calipers, and are used to measure the length, width, or outside diameter of an object. Inside micrometers are typically used to measure interior diameter, as in a hole. Depth micrometers measure the height, or depth, of any shape that has a step, groove, or slot.Brown & Sharpe manufactures precision measuring equipment and metrology hand tools. The company, founded in 1833, played a key role in setting industrial standards in the United States. Brown & Sharpe was acquired by Hexagon Metrology in 2001, and is headquartered in North Kingstown, RI.
